Comprehensive Design Support and Rapid Prototyping Capabilities
Exceptional injection moulding products manufacturers offer far more than basic manufacturing services; they provide comprehensive design support and rapid prototyping capabilities that accelerate product development and optimize manufacturability. These manufacturers employ experienced design engineers who collaborate with clients from the earliest concept stages, offering valuable insights into how design decisions affect production efficiency, cost, and functionality. This design-for-manufacturing expertise helps identify potential issues before expensive tooling is created, saving time and money while improving final product quality. The design support services offered by professional injection moulding products manufacturers include computer-aided design assistance, mold flow analysis, material selection guidance, and finite element analysis to predict how parts will perform under real-world conditions. Mold flow analysis is particularly valuable, as it simulates how molten plastic fills the cavity, revealing potential problems like air traps, weld lines, or warping issues. By addressing these concerns during the design phase, manufacturers help you avoid costly tooling modifications later. Rapid prototyping capabilities represent another critical advantage of working with advanced injection moulding products manufacturers. Using technologies such as 3D printing, CNC machining, and soft tooling, these manufacturers can produce functional prototypes quickly, allowing you to test form, fit, and function before committing to production tooling. This iterative approach enables design refinements based on actual physical testing rather than theoretical assumptions. You can evaluate ergonomics, assess assembly processes, conduct user testing, and verify performance characteristics with prototype parts that closely replicate production components. Some injection moulding products manufacturers offer bridge tooling solutions that produce limited quantities using simplified molds, providing an intermediate step between prototyping and full production. This approach is ideal for market testing, pre-launch production, or meeting early customer commitments while final production tooling is being fabricated.
